Lottie Woad Wins Augusta National Women's Amateur Title

In a breathtaking display of skill and nerve, England's Lottie Woad has etched her name into golfing history with a spectacular victory at the prestigious Augusta National Women's Amateur. The 20-year-old amateur sensation produced a stunning final-round comeback, clinching the title with a dramatic birdie on the legendary 18th hole.

A Final Round For The History Books

Trailing by two shots with just four holes to play, Woad demonstrated the composure of a seasoned professional. The Florida State University student ignited her charge with a crucial birdie on the 15th, setting the stage for a grandstand finish at the hallowed grounds of Augusta National.

The Moment of Glory

With the championship on the line, Woad faced a pressure-packed approach shot on the final hole. Her magnificent wedge shot settled within eight feet of the pin, setting up the birdie putt that would seal her victory. The ball found the centre of the cup, sparking emotional celebrations from the young champion and her supporters.

Future Prospects Brighten

This landmark win not only earns Woad one of amateur golf's most coveted titles but also secures her invitations to three major championships this season. The triumph marks a watershed moment in the young golfer's career, positioning her as one of the most exciting prospects in world golf.

Woad's victory continues England's recent success in the tournament, following in the footsteps of compatriot Anna Davis who claimed the title in 2022. The performance underscores the strength of British amateur golf and promises an exciting future for the Surrey-born star.
